H2 HGF is a 2017 Porsche Cayenne in Black with a 2,967c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.

Across all 2017 Porsche Cayenne models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.1% with a typical mileage of 49,316 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Porsche Cayenne f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 5,217 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H2 HGF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Porsche Cayenne typ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 9 years old, this Porsche Cayenne is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
